Title :
Pixel Behaviour Metrics for Dynamic Background Modelling with the Projected Difference Pattern Method
Author :
Pakulski, Peter ; Sammut, Karl ; He, Fangpo ; Naylor, Matthew
Author_Institution :
Flinders University
Abstract :
This paper presents a new algorithm for modelling the behaviour of dynamic video. The PDP (Projected Difference Pattern) is designed to perform simple spatiotemporal processing with a strong focus on efficiency of real-time implementation. In its simplest implementation, the algorithm is shown to be suitable for generating dynamic background models, motion characterisation, and motion detection. Sample analyses of test video are presented to support this work.
